Photo News: Tawur Kesanga
Photos of Tawur Kesanga ceremony at Puputan square in Denpasar, Sunday, March 18, 2007.
A day prior to Nyepi, or Balinese New Year, the great Tawur Kesanga ritual is held all over Bali.
The tawur kesanga ceremony in regency level is held in the major crossroad of near the center of the regency. In Denpasar it is held in Puputan square, in front of Museum Bali. This ritual needs a caru rsigana offering that consist of the same animal as the panca kelud plus a white duck.
